Voting alignment

Warinder Juss and Alison Bennett voted the same way 20% of the time, based on 369 shared comparable votes.

73 same votes 296 different votes 369 shared votes

Alignment only includes divisions where both MPs recorded an Aye or No vote. Tellers, absences, abstentions, and missing votes are excluded.
